You are not logged in.

Ossigott90

Trainee

  • "Ossigott90" started this thread

Posts: 96

Location: Berlin

Occupation: 360° - Visualisierungen

  • Send private message

1

Friday, February 17th 2017, 3:13pm

Maxx Zoom out

Wie kann ich einstellen das ich bei jedem Standpunkt die maximale rauszoomstufe diese ist das ich mich nicht über das Stativ bewegen kann?

Ossigott90

Trainee

  • "Ossigott90" started this thread

Posts: 96

Location: Berlin

Occupation: 360° - Visualisierungen

  • Send private message

2

Monday, February 20th 2017, 8:58am

Das waren meine Einstellungen unter Flash:

<view hlookat="0" vlookat="0" maxpixelzoom="1.5" limitview="range" vlookatmin="-90" vlookatmax="83" fovmax="135" />
<display details="22" />

die gleichen bei HTML5 ergeben leider nicht mehr das gleiche Ergebnis,
ich möchte ein Blick festlegen bei dem man beim rauszoomen nicht alles klein und verzerrt dargestellt bekommt.
Ein normales menschliches Sichtfeld und nicht weiter rauszoombar.

Habe schon mit allen Werten gespielt aber ich komm nicht auf die Lösung.

Ossigott90

Trainee

  • "Ossigott90" started this thread

Posts: 96

Location: Berlin

Occupation: 360° - Visualisierungen

  • Send private message

3

Monday, February 20th 2017, 9:19am

<krpano version="1.18.5" onstart="loadscene(Test_004,null,MERGE|KEEPVIEW);" >


<scene name="Test_004" >


<view hlookat="0" vlookat="0" maxpixelzoom="1.5" limitview="range" vlookatmin="-90" vlookatmax="83" fovmax="135" />


<preview url="Test_004.kacheln/vorschau.jpg" />

<image type="CUBE" multires="true" tilesize="666">
<level tiledimagewidth="12340" tiledimageheight="12340">
<cube url="Test_004.kacheln/l5_%s_0%v_0%h.jpg" />
</level>
<level tiledimagewidth="6170" tiledimageheight="6170">
<cube url="Test_004.kacheln/l4_%s_0%v_0%h.jpg" />
</level>
<level tiledimagewidth="3086" tiledimageheight="3086">
<cube url="Test_004.kacheln/l3_%s_0%v_0%h.jpg" />
</level>
<level tiledimagewidth="1544" tiledimageheight="1544">
<cube url="Test_004.kacheln/l2_%s_0%v_0%h.jpg" />
</level>
<level tiledimagewidth="772" tiledimageheight="772">
<cube url="Test_004.kacheln/l1_%s_0%v_0%h.jpg" />
</level>
</image>


So starte ich meine einzelnen Standpunkte, habe aber das Problem das ich die Startblickwinkeleinstellungen nicht ändern kann. Das geht nur wenn ich von der onstart Funktion das KEEPVIEW entferne, dann bekomme ich die Ansicht die ich möchte aber ich kann kein Blickwinkel mehr von einem zum nächsten Standpunkt übergeben.

Hat einer eine Lösung?

4

Wednesday, February 22nd 2017, 7:04am

Hi,

durch das KEEPVIEW werden die aktuelle 'view' Werte (auch das fovmax) beibehalten.

D.h. entweder müsste dann auch das fovmax vorher (z.B. außerhalb der <scene>) gesetzt werden:

Source code

1
2
3
4
5
6
<krpano onstart="loadscene(...);">
<view fovmax="135" />
<scene>
...
</scene>
</krpano>


Oder in der Szene wird z.B. per onstart Event der fovmax Wert explizit per Action gesetzt - z.B.

Source code

1
2
3
<scene onstart="set(view.fovmax, 135);">
...
</scene>


Schöne Grüße,
Klaus

toosten

Intermediate

Posts: 521

Location: Berlin

Occupation: Software-Entwickler bei VR-Easy ( HTML, JS, PHP, krpano, C++, Java )

  • Send private message

5

Wednesday, February 22nd 2017, 8:37am

Hi,

durch das KEEPVIEW werden die aktuelle 'view' Werte (auch das fovmax) beibehalten.

...

( Aber nicht wenn jede Scene in einer eigenen HTML-Seite steckt! )